Transaction 984ed349e732bc314c769b4d214a21241b5e84c1bd5a5c25c61809d2651ca63b
1 Input
2 Outputs
- 984ed349e732bc314c769b4d214a21241b5e84c1bd5a5c25c61809d2651ca63b:0
- 984ed349e732bc314c769b4d214a21241b5e84c1bd5a5c25c61809d2651ca63b:1
value 40000000
address 3MuJM5yrgnzQ9SfE91U3snrvsprRv8Cm9r
value 2959992818
address 1BtzRdjdXYQE6xRcHzL2tuhpaMfuR1r2G6